TYPES OF CCTV SYSTEMS

Analogue CCTV - These are the traditional systems which can monitor and record using multiple cameras. Recording images and video onto digital video recorders, these systems can additionally send data to your smartphone or laptop by means of an internet link. If local police need to see evidence that's been recorded on your DVR system, it can readily be transferred to a USB memory stick or CD/DVD for simple viewing. These are designed to work as an independent CCTV system with an optional connection to the web. Opting for a CCTV system with remote viewing capabilities can provide added convenience and accessibility, allowing you to view real-time footage of your home or property from anyplace with an internet connection.

Internet Protocol Systems - With IP camera systems, recording and monitoring can be accomplished through the internet, with a wide area network or via a local intranet. Each camera has got its own IP address and links to a specific gateway on a computer system or DVR. IP cameras can additionally send video footage, pictures and notifications directly to your mobile, subsequently adding a further security layer by stopping an intruder from removing evidence from an on-site DVR. But, the security features and encryption have to be set up properly to stop any unauthorised viewing of your cameras and their recordings.

Cloud Based CCTV Systems - Use a secure encrypted gateway to record footage to "cloud" storage. Both analogue and IP systems are able to use cloud based technology along with their basic recording functions. Cloud recording generally has a monthly or annual fee which is determined by the amount of space required on servers and whether or not you require remote monitoring by a security company.

LIGHTING FOR CAMERAS

To provide video recording for the gloomiest of situations, many CCTV cameras on the market now come with some kind of infrared lighting built-in. Any infrared camera will record video in black and white in the night time and at a somewhat lower resolution than the device's daytime recordings. It is possible, if you think the night vision resolution is too low for your requirements, to set up special security lamps that generate a natural light source for your CCTV system. In addition to providing brighter lights when any motion is detected by the system, such lighting equipment can provide a daylight effect for your system.

If you decide to use motion detection security lighting with your CCTV system, you must make sure that the light doesn't point towards any oncoming traffic areas, or into neighbours gardens and properties.

CCTV - THE LAW

You are not now exempt from the Data Protection Act, if you've got household CCTV cameras that capture images over your property's perimeter, into a neighbouring garden or a public area. This Act does not mean the use of cameras are illegal, but any data stored must be safeguarded from potential misuse for any individual who appears in the recordings.

The Information Commissioner's Office (ICO) can provide advice on the regulations in regards to the monitoring and recording of public or neighbouring areas, which includes specific instructions regarding notices to the public of your use of CCTV cameras. By hiring a qualified CCTV service in Witley for the installation of your CCTV cameras, you can make certain that all legal guidelines are fully met and adhered to.

Planning permission for a CCTV system placed on the exterior of your home may be needed if you live in a national park, you live in a conservation area, you're putting them onto a listed building or you're in a place of special scientific interest. Planning permission can be sidestepped on the vast majority of other properties in Witley provided that the cameras and lights don't jut out from your outside walls by more than one metre and they are positioned at least 2.5 metres from the ground.

TRAINING, ACCREDITATION, STANDARDS AND PROFESSIONAL MEMBERSHIPS

When picking out a CCTV system for your Witley property only consider the British Standard BS EN 62676 kitemark Laying out recommendations for CCTV that's installed for security reasons, it describes minimum performance and functional requirements. Having a BS EN 62676 compliant system is not legally necessary in the UK, but if you put in a system that is not up to British Standards and which doesn't meet your expectations and might not have been tested thoroughly, you might have little if any recourse after installation.

The National Security Inspectorate - The NSI is the most trusted independent professional organisation for CCTV, fire safety and security firms throughout Great Britain. The vetting process is strict and includes a company showcasing their competence in the design, installation and maintenance of an array of security and fire safety equipment. A security must also substantiate they have vetted and trained personnel effectively, own suitable vehicles and equipment in their area of expertise, and that their business premises are suitable to promote the security industry in a good light. In the United Kingdom, it is acknowledged as the topmost standard by the police, insurance providers and fire services.

The SI - Security Institute - The biggest of all the trade organisations for security specialists, the Security Institute is recognised and respected within the security industry. The SI guarantees that its four thousand plus members will provide the highest possible standards of workmanship, and follow best working practice in security installation, planning and maintenance.

Secure By Design (SBD) - Secured by Design is the police security initiative which works to improve the security of buildings and their locality to provide safe places to live, shop, visit and work. Its aims are to improve the physical security of all buildings by working with construction firms, security companies and architects.

The British Security Industry Association - With regard to the United Kingdom's security and CCTV industry, the BSIA is one of the most significant trade bodies. All BSIA members have to be must adhere to the Codes of Practice for the industry, and must abide by ISO 9000 International regulations, and the relevant British Standards for security installations.

Unlike traditional bullet cameras with a boxy design, dome cameras feature a streamlined dome-shaped housing that contains the internal components and lens. This concept offers a number of benefits:

  1. Vandal-Resistant and Discreet: The clever design of a dome camera offers a dual layer of security. The rounded, smooth surface makes it physically difficult to tamper with or damage the lens. Additionally, the lack of protruding angles prevents potential intruders from knowing where the camera is facing, keeping them unclear about whether they are being tracked.
  2. 360-Degree Rotation: Imagine a security camera that can see it all! PTZ (pan-tilt-zoom) CCTV dome cameras offer just that. These leading-edge models boast pan, tilt, and zoom capabilities, enabling them to rotate a full three hundred and sixty degrees. This wide-ranging view effectively eliminates blind spots and ensures no corner goes unmonitored.
  3. Weatherproof: Don't let the elements compromise your security! Most dome cameras are weatherproof warriors. They are able to withstand dust, rain, snow, and other environmental impacts, ensuring continuous monitoring outdoors or indoors. This flexibility makes them the best choice for all-weather protection.
  4. Wider Field of View: In comparison to traditional bullet-style cameras, dome cameras usually provide a wider viewing angle, allowing coverage of a larger area with just one camera and hence lowering the amount of cameras needed for an extensive security system.
  5. Visually Pleasing: Security shouldn't come at the expense of looks! Dome cameras offer a win-win situation. Their modern, sleek design allows them to seamlessly blend with any architectural style, making them a visually pleasing choice for security.

Night Vision CCTV Cameras

What is Night Vision CCTV? - Night vision CCTV is a security camera system equipped with infrared (IR) technology that enables the camera to record clear images and videos in low light or no light conditions. The infrared technology illuminates the area being monitored and creates pictures in black and white, providing a sharp and clear view even in total darkness.

Night vision CCTV cameras are generally used for a number of security applications, including commercial and residential properties, industrial premises, and other locations where surveillance is required at night time. They come in various types, such as dome cameras, PTZ cameras and bullet cameras, each with different features to suit different surveillance needs. Some night vision cameras can provide up to one hundred feet of visibility in full darkness, meaning they're ideal for large outside areas. The footage that these cameras capture can be monitored in real-time or recorded for later review, providing an added layer of security for homes and businesses in Witley.

Non-functional surveillance cameras designed to fool any person who they are supposedly watching, including intruders, are known as dummy CCTV cameras, decoy or fake security cameras. Those cameras are put in a place where people passing by will see them, so that they will believe the area is being monitored by real CCTV.

Dummy CCTV cameras can be made to look like genuine cameras, with a lens, housing, and even a blinking light. Dummy cameras with motion sensors can activate a flashing light or recording device, which can deter crime.

Many reasons exist for businesses and homeowners in Witley to choose dummy CCTV cameras. For one, they can be a cost-effective way to discourage burglars. CCTV cameras can deter crime by up to 30%, research has shown. Security awareness among employees and customers can also be improved by fake cameras.

Another benefit of fake CCTV cameras is that they can be used to monitor blind spots or areas that are hard to cover. This is a particularly useful solution for complex or large properties.

Dummy CCTV cameras are not a substitute for real cameras, but they can be a valuable deterrent. Video and audio recording are not possible with dummy CCTV cameras, nor can they be used to identify burglars. Fake CCTV cameras can still be an invaluable deterrent to crime, and they can also help to improve security awareness.

CCTV and Data Protection

Your use of a CCTV system will be subject to the current data protection laws for the UK if you decide to fit CCTV in your home in Witley and it records footage beyond your property's boundary, such as a neighbour's garden, an alleyway or a public street.

If your system is recording such images, it doesn't mean that you're actually breaking any laws, but under the Data Protection Act you are considered to be a "data controller", and will have to comply with your legal obligations in these circumstances.

In order to uphold the rights of people whose images you're capturing, you can still collect images and video footage, but you must demonstrate you're accomplishing it in ways that conform to the data protection laws.

If you're filming images and video footage outside of the perimeter of your property:

  • You should put up clear signage to confirm that recording is taking place.
  • When asked by the ICO or an individual, you should be able to explain the rationale for recording this footage.
  • You should not improperly use the system nor permit others to do so.
  • You should acknowledge subject access requests (SARs) when within 30 days of being received.
  • You must be able to give a specific and justifiable reason for wanting to film such images.
  • You should erase footage of individual people if they ask that you do this.
  • You must keep safe and guarantee the security of any recorded footage.
  • You should only keep captured images for as long as they're required, and erase them frequently.
  • You should only film necessary footage for your purpose, and never more than is actually needed.

Can CCTV Lower My Insurance Costs?

We're regularly asked about this, and the answer we typically give is "Not Really". A minimal discount might be offered by certain insurance firms, where CCTV is installed, but normally only when it is being used alongside a burglar alarm or more elaborate security system. Even in the case of a burglar alarm, many insurance companies will not give you a discount unless the alarm is professionally installed.

CCTV Insurance Costs Witley

The principal factors that set the price of your home insurance is where you live (your particular postcode), the value of your house and what level of contents insurance you need. Actually, the predominant factor is the current crime rate in your area.

The fact remains that most properties in Witley still do not have CCTV, and if you try looking this from the insurance company's viewpoint, they may well speculate on why you have chosen to install cameras. It may be that there's been increased criminal activity in your part of Witley and you are taking additional precautions - this could be seen as a heightened risk by your insurance company.

When all is said and done, the best reasons for installing CCTV should be that it increases your sense of security, it supplies evidence in the event of a break-in or offence and it warns off criminals.

Notices or signs that advise people a location in Witley is being monitored by a CCTV system are referred to as CCTV signage. As well as informing people that their movements and actions are being recorded, CCTV also serves as a deterrent to anti-social behaviour or criminal activity.

CCTV signage is required by law in the United Kingdom if it looks beyond the property boundary, and it must meet certain specifications and standards. For instance, the CCTV signs need to be prominently displayed and easy to read, including details like the name of the organisation or person in charge of the cameras and the procedure by which recorded video footage can be accessed by individuals.

The inclusion of CCTV signage is a key aspect of any CCTV camera system, helping to ensure that camera operation complies with both local and national legal standards and regulations.
